Background

Best Hotels near Villa Carlotta

Discover the best hotels near Villa Carlotta. Find inspiration for your trip with our curated list of top-rated spots, local favorites, and hidden gems.

The 10 best hotels near Villa Carlotta

Other hotels near Villa Carlotta

More about Villa Carlotta

photo

Discover the beauty of art and nature at Villa Carlotta, a historic gem on the shores of Lake Como, Italy. Immerse yourself in stunning gardens and exquisite art.

Tell me more about Villa Carlotta

Select Currency